Organizers of the Honea Path Merchants Association 4th Annual Honea Path Idol contest are looking for talented individuals or groups that would like to perform in a community event.

The event will take place on Thursday August 16th at 6:30 p.m. on North Main Street in the downtown area. Main Street will be closed to all traffic during and prior to the event. There will be food vendors for those who wish to take a night away from the kitchen duties along with the Little Town Coffee House and Bubba’s Ice Cream Shop for those who like cool delights and adventurous eating.

Applications can be picked up at B&R Books, McCall’s Produce, and on line at honeapathmerchants.com. All Entries must be received prior to close of business August 13th

Trophies, prize money, photo ops for the local newspapers and an invite to perform at the Sugarfoot festival will be awarded to the 1st, 2nd and 3rd place winners.

Awards will be presented at the end of the competition along with photos for local newspapers.
